What kinds of projects or tasks can I expect to work on as an Apprentice Machine Learning Testing?

As an Apprentice Machine Learning Testing, you’ll typically assist in evaluating machine learning models by designing and running tests, analyzing model outputs, and helping identify issues like bias or overfitting. You may work closely with data scientists and software engineers to validate model performance and ensure results align with project objectives. Your daily tasks might include preparing test datasets, executing automated testing scripts, and documenting findings to help improve model reliability. This role often serves as a valuable introduction to practical machine learning workflows and quality assurance processes in technical teams.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Apprentice Machine Learning Testing,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Apprentice in Machine Learning Testing, a foundational understanding of statistics, programming (especially Python), and basic machine learning concepts is essential, often supported by a degree or coursework in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, Jupyter Notebooks, and version control systems is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help apprentices collaborate and identify testing issues efficiently. These skills ensure accurate model validation, effective troubleshooting, and contribute to the robust deployment of machine learning solutions.

What does an Apprentice Machine Learning Testing do?

An Apprentice Machine Learning Testing professional assists in evaluating and validating machine learning models to ensure they perform as expected. They typically work under the guidance of experienced data scientists or engineers, running tests, analyzing results, and helping to identify issues such as bias or inaccuracies in algorithms. Their responsibilities may also include developing test cases, writing reports, and learning about data preprocessing and evaluation metrics. This role is ideal for those who are new to the field and want to build foundational skills in machine learning quality assurance.

KSB is a leading supplier of pumps, valves and related service. Our reliable, high-efficiency products are used in applications wherever fluids need to be transported or shut off, covering everything from building services,industry and water transport to waste water treatment, power plant processes and mining. Founded in 1871 in Frankenthal, Germany, the company has a presence on all continents with its own sales and marketing organisations and manufacturing facilities. Around the globe, more than 190 service centres and around 3,500 service specialists are on hand to provide local inspection, servicing, maintenance and repair services under the KSB SupremeServ brand. Innovative technology that is the fruit of KSB's research and development activities forms the basis for the company's success.

Machine Learning Engineer KSB GIW, Inc.

Department: Engineering, Research & Development
Reports to: Metallurgical and Materials R&D Lab Manager
Location: Grovetown, GA, USA (onsite)
Shift: First

FLSA Status: Salary Exempt

OVERVIEW:

Our R&D group is expanding its use of machine learning to solve real engineering problems, and we're looking for a sharp, hands-on early-career engineer to join the team.

You'll work at the intersection of machine learning and the physical world to build AI systems that learn from real industrial data and connect with the engineering models behind them. The role lives where machine learning meets scientific computing: surrogate modeling, data-driven approximations of physical systems, and ML models that respect the underlying engineering principles.

You'll build the data foundation that powers this work, implement and train models that bridge physics-based simulation with modern machine learning, and work closely with an experienced technical lead who will guide your growth across data engineering, scientific ML, and emerging AI tooling.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Build and maintain the data foundation: ingestion, cleaning, transformation, validation, and metadata standards
  • Implement and train machine learning models using Python and modern frameworks (PyTorch)
  • Contribute to applied AI tooling that supports the broader R&D workflow
  • Develop visualization and dashboard interfaces that present results to end users
  • Run experiments, track results, and report findings against defined targets
  • Help bring prototype code to production quality: testing, documentation, version control
  • Collaborate with team members across engineering disciplines

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Education:Bachelor's degree required; master's preferred in Computer Science, Engineering, Applied Math, Physics, or a related field
  • Experience:1-3 years of professional or substantial project experience in machine learning, data engineering, or scientific computing

SKILLS / COMPETENCIES

Required:
  • Solid Python skills with hands-on experience using core libraries:
    • Machine learning: PyTorch, scikit-learn
    • Data: NumPy, pandas
    • Scientific computing: SciPy, Matplotlib
  • Foundational understanding of scientific computing: numerical methods, simulation concepts, or modeling of physical systems - this is essential to the role
  • Foundational understanding of neural networks, model training, and optimization
  • Experience with version control (Git) and working in a Linux environment
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Collaborative, coachable attitude
Preferred:
  • Experience building and maintaining data pipelines, metadata schemas, and data quality frameworks
  • Exposure to scientific / physics-informed machine learning (surrogate modeling, embedding physical constraints into ML models)
  • Background in CFD, simulation, computational mechanics, or applied physics
  • Familiarity with agentic AI / LLM frameworks (LangChain, LangGraph, or similar) enough to collaborate effectively, not lead
  • Experience with Jupyter, Docker, MLflow, or FastAPI
  • Front-end / dashboard development experience (React)
  • Cloud compute (AWS or Azure) and GPU-based training
  • Coursework or research projects in numerical methods, engineering, or applied science
